Understanding Cadaver Bags and Kits


Cadaver bags are specialized items used to contain and transport cadavers. These bags are typically made from high-quality materials that are durable, waterproof, and resistant to various environmental factors. Features often include a zippered closure, handles for ease of transport, and sometimes additional components that help in the management of biological hazards. Cadaver kits, on the other hand, may include various tools and equipment that aid in the management and preservation of human remains, such as disinfectants, protective gear, labeling materials, and organ preservation solutions.


The primary users of these products include hospitals, forensic labs, research institutions, and mortuaries, which necessitates adherence to health and safety regulations across different regions. Therefore, manufacturers must ensure that their products meet international standards and are compliant with the guidelines set forth by health authorities.


Market Trends and Growth Drivers


The market for cadaver bags and kits is witnessing robust growth due to several factors. First and foremost, the increasing number of autopsies and forensic investigations, driven by growing awareness of crime scene investigation and forensic science, boosts demand. Moreover, the rise in organ donation and transplant programs further fuels the need for effective and respectful transportation and storage solutions for cadavers.


In addition to these factors, the global health crisis posed by the COVID-19 pandemic has underscored the importance of proper handling and disposal of human remains. As countries dealt with unprecedented mortality rates, there was a surge in demand for cadaver management supplies, pushing many manufacturers to expand their production capacities and explore international markets.

International Trade and Export Considerations


Exporting cadaver bags and kits requires a nuanced understanding of international regulations and trade practices. Different countries have varying requirements regarding the handling of biological materials and medical products. Therefore, exporters must stay informed about local laws, import permits, and certification processes.


Furthermore, building strong relationships with regulatory bodies and stakeholders in target markets is crucial. The need for transparency and compliance cannot be overstated, as failure to adhere to local regulations can result in fines, bans, or reputational damage.


The COVID-19 pandemic has also influenced trade dynamics, leading to supply chain disruptions. As exporters navigate these challenges, developing robust logistics and distribution networks becomes essential. Partnering with reliable shipping companies and local distributors can ensure timely delivery and adherence to safety protocols when transporting cadaver bags and kits.
